Empire State Realty Trust is a leading real estate investment trust that owns, manages, and operates a portfolio of premium commercial, residential, and retail properties primarily in the New York City metropolitan area, including the iconic Empire State Building. It serves corporate tenants, retail partners, and residential occupants, focusing on sustainable property operations and long-term asset value growth.
